"A love for the lush Cambodian countryside and its charming rural architecture led four Swiss and French friends to open Sala Lodgesin 2012. They amassed 11 stunning examples of the wooden homes on stilts that punctuate the Khmer landscape, hiring carpenters to carefully select, disassemble, transport, and resurrect them on alush village-like property in Siem Reap not far from the temples. Each house has its unique style and story to tell—the oldest ones date to the late 1950s. Antiques, canopied beds, soft lighting, and pastel-hued fabrics, updated with essential modern-day luxuries like air conditioning and rain showers, now fill the majestic structures. Indigenous trees and plants like palm, papaya, and banana trees, and rice fields populated by little frogs and chirping crickets, are an ode to local village life. The generous layout of the rooms and verandas lends a languid atmosphere perfect for taking in the property’s enchanting sights and sounds while contemplating the splendor of Angkor."

Angkor Century Resort and Spa

Resort hotel · Siem Reab

High-end spa resort with an outdoor lagoon pool & an airy restaurant with live entertainment. This upscale spa resort is 7 km from Angkor Wat temple and 12 km from the Siem Reap International Airport. Featuring free Wi-Fi, the chic rooms and suites mix modern with traditional decor, and have balconies with pool views. All also offer cable TV, minifridges, and tea and coffeemakers. Suites add separate living areas. Room service is available. The resort has an outdoor lagoon pool and an airy restaurant with international dishes and live entertainment, plus a spa offering treatments such as traditional massage. Other amenities include 2 informal bars and a terrace with seating overlooking the pool.

Okay Guesthouse Siem Reap

Guest house · Siem Reab

Simple rooms in a relaxed guesthouse with a restaurant, a pool & parking, plus complimentary Wi-Fi. Set in a residential neighborhood, this informal guesthouse is a 12-minute walk from the closest bus stop, 2 km from Siem Reap Art Center Night Market, and 8 km from Angkor Wat, a temple complex dating from the 9th century. The simple rooms have free Wi-Fi, TVs and minifridges, plus fans or air-conditioning. Upgraded rooms add balconies, claw-foot tubs, safes, and tea and coffeemakers. Room service is available. A laid-back rooftop restaurant/bar serves Khmer and Western cuisine, and is flanked by a pool, palm trees and sunloungers. Other amenities include an Internet cafe and massage services. Breakfast and parking are available.
